Understanding the Majestic English Mastiff: Origin, Traits, and Care

The English Mastiff, a breed synonymous with grandeur and nobility, has a rich history that traces back to ancient times. Originally from England, these dogs were bred for their immense size and strength, often used as guard dogs or for bear-baiting in medieval Europe. Their roots can be traced back to the Molossus, a now-extinct dog known for its size and ferocity, used by the Roman army.

Type and Coat Type: The English Mastiff is classified as a working dog due to its historical roles. They possess a short, straight outer coat with a dense, shorter undercoat, providing ample protection from various weather conditions.

Distinctive Coat Colors: Typically, their coat colors range from fawn, apricot, to brindle. Each color adds to their majestic appearance, making them quite the sight.

Size: Known for their colossal size, English Mastiffs are one of the heaviest dog breeds. Males can weigh anywhere from 160 to 230 pounds or more, while females are slightly smaller.

Origin: As their name suggests, they originate from England and have been a part of British culture for centuries.

Energy Level: Despite their size, English Mastiffs are not high-energy dogs. They enjoy a good romp but are equally content with lounging around the house.

Intelligence and Trainability: This breed is intelligent and eager to please, which makes them relatively easy to train. However, their training should start early and include positive reinforcement techniques due to their sensitive nature.

Longevity: Their lifespan typically ranges from 6 to 10 years, which is standard for dogs of their size.

Unique Physical Traits: Beyond their size, English Mastiffs have a distinctive broad head, a black mask, and dark, expressive eyes that add to their dignified demeanor.

Grooming: Their short coat makes grooming relatively easy, requiring regular brushing to keep it clean and reduce shedding.

Socialization: Socialization is crucial for English Mastiffs. Given their size and strength, they need to learn to interact well with people and other animals from a young age.

Loyalty: They are known for their loyalty and protective instincts, often forming a strong bond with their family.

Instincts: Initially bred for guarding, they have a natural protective instinct, making them excellent watchdogs. However, they are known for their gentle nature, especially around their family.

The English Mastiff is a gentle giant, combining strength and a calm demeanor with loyalty and intelligence. Their distinctive appearance, coupled with their rich history and unique traits, makes them a fascinating and beloved breed. Proper care, including adequate training, socialization, and grooming, ensures these dogs lead a healthy, happy, and well-adjusted life.

Navigating the Health Landscape: Common Issues in English Mastiffs

English Mastiffs, like all breeds, come with their own set of health concerns that potential and current owners should be aware of. Understanding these issues is key to providing the best care and ensuring a long, healthy life for these gentle giants.

Hip and Elbow Dysplasia: Common in many large breeds, these conditions occur when the hip or elbow joints don’t develop properly, potentially leading to arthritis or lameness. Regular check-ups, proper nutrition, and maintaining a healthy weight can help manage these conditions.

Gastric Dilatation-Volvulus (GDV): Also known as bloat, GDV is a life-threatening condition where the stomach fills with gas and twists. Preventive measures include feeding smaller, more frequent meals and avoiding vigorous exercise around feeding times.

Heart Conditions: English Mastiffs are prone to certain heart conditions, such as cardiomyopathy. Regular veterinary check-ups and monitoring for signs of heart disease are essential.

Cancer: Like many large breeds, Mastiffs may be at a higher risk for certain types of cancer. Early detection through regular vet visits is crucial for treatment and management.

Obesity: Their large size can make them prone to weight gain, which can exacerbate joint issues and other health problems. A balanced diet and regular exercise are key to keeping them at a healthy weight.

Eye Problems: Conditions such as progressive retinal atrophy, cataracts, and cherry eye can occur in this breed. Regular eye exams can help catch and treat these issues early.

Hypothyroidism: This is a condition where the thyroid gland doesn’t produce enough hormones, affecting metabolism. Symptoms include weight gain, lethargy, and skin problems. It’s typically manageable with medication.

Skin Conditions: Due to their folds and wrinkles, Mastiffs can be prone to skin infections. Regular grooming and cleaning of these areas can help prevent issues.

While English Mastiffs are generally robust and healthy, awareness of these common health issues is essential for any Mastiff owner. Proactive care, regular veterinary check-ups, and a healthy lifestyle are key to managing these conditions and ensuring the well-being of these magnificent dogs.

The Balanced Plate: Nutritional Essentials for English Mastiffs

Understanding the nutritional needs of the English Mastiff is crucial for maintaining their overall health and wellbeing. Given their colossal size and specific physical makeup, English Mastiffs require a carefully balanced diet to support their bone structure, muscle mass, and energy levels.

Caloric Intake: Due to their massive size, English Mastiffs require a significant amount of calories. However, these should come from high-quality sources to prevent obesity, a common problem in large breeds. An ideal diet balances proteins, fats, and carbohydrates in appropriate ratios.

Protein: High-quality proteins are essential for muscle maintenance and overall growth. Sources like lean meats (chicken, beef, lamb), fish, and eggs provide the amino acids necessary for muscle development and repair.

Fats: Healthy fats are vital for energy and coat health. Sources like fish oil and flaxseed contribute to a shiny coat and healthy skin, while also providing essential fatty acids that support brain and heart health.

Carbohydrates: While less crucial than proteins and fats, carbohydrates are still important for providing energy. Complex carbs like brown rice and vegetables can also offer fiber, which aids in digestion.

Vitamins and Minerals: A balanced intake of vitamins and minerals supports overall health. Calcium and phosphorus are particularly important for bone health, considering the Mastiff’s large frame and potential for joint issues.

Joint Health: Supplements like glucosamine and chondroitin can be beneficial for maintaining joint health, a common concern for large breeds.

Water: Adequate hydration is essential. English Mastiffs should always have access to fresh water, especially considering their size and the amount of food they consume.

Feeding English Mastiffs requires a focus on quality and balance. Their diet should cater to their specific needs as a large breed, ensuring they remain healthy, active, and happy throughout their lives. Regular check-ups with a veterinarian can help tailor their diet more precisely, addressing any specific health concerns or dietary needs.

From Puppyhood to Golden Years: A Comprehensive Feeding Guide for English Mastiffs

Feeding an English Mastiff correctly through various stages of their life is crucial for their health and longevity. This guide provides insights into their dietary needs from puppyhood to their senior years, ensuring they get the right nutrients at each stage.

Puppy Stage (0-18 months)

English Mastiff puppies grow rapidly and require a diet rich in protein to support their muscle and bone development.

  • Feed high-quality puppy food specially formulated for large breeds.
  • Puppies should be fed three to four times a day in smaller portions to support their fast growth and high energy needs.
  • Avoid overfeeding to prevent rapid growth, which can lead to joint problems.

Adolescence to Adulthood (18 months-3 years)

As they transition to adulthood, their growth rate slows down.

  • Gradually shift to adult dog food formulated for large breeds.
  • Reduce feeding frequency to twice a day but ensure each meal is nutritionally complete.
  • Monitor their weight and adjust food portions to prevent obesity.

Adult Stage (3-8 years)

Maintenance is key during their adult years.

  • Continue with high-quality adult dog food, ensuring it’s appropriate for their size and activity level.
  • Keep a consistent feeding schedule with controlled portions to maintain a healthy weight.
  • Monitor for any signs of food allergies or sensitivities.

Senior Stage (8 years and above)

Older English Mastiffs often require diets that cater to changing health needs.

  • Switch to a senior dog food formula, which typically has fewer calories but still provides essential nutrients.
  • Consider supplements like glucosamine and chondroitin for joint health.
  • Monitor their appetite and adjust feeding as necessary – senior dogs may have a reduced appetite or difficulty eating.

General Tips

  • Always provide fresh water to keep them hydrated.
  • Be mindful of treats and human food, which can lead to weight gain.
  • Regular vet check-ups can help tailor their diet more precisely, addressing any specific health concerns or dietary needs.

Giving the best food for English Mastiffs at each life stage is essential to ensure they remain healthy, active, and happy throughout their lives. Regular monitoring and adjustments to their diet, in consultation with a vet, can help address any health issues that may arise.

FAQs on English Mastiff Diet and Nutrition

What foods should be avoided for English Mastiffs?

Avoid foods that are toxic to dogs, like chocolate and grapes, and high-fat or overly processed foods that can lead to obesity.

Are supplements necessary for English Mastiffs?

Some Mastiffs may benefit from supplements like glucosamine for joint health, but consult your vet for personalized advice.

Is wet or dry food better for English Mastiffs?

Both can be suitable; wet food can aid hydration and palatability, while dry food is good for dental health. A combination can be ideal.

How do I know if my English Mastiff is overweight?

Regular vet check-ups and monitoring for visible waistlines and palpable ribs under a thin layer of fat are key indicators.

Can English Mastiffs have a vegetarian diet?

While possible, it’s challenging to meet their nutritional needs with a vegetarian diet; consult a vet for a well-planned meal plan.
